发明名称 CARRIER FOR ELECTROSTATIC LATENT IMAGE DEVELOPMENT, ELECTROSTATIC LATENT IMAGE DEVELOPER USING THE SAME, IMAGE FORMING METHOD, AND PROCESS CARTRIDGE
摘要 PROBLEM TO BE SOLVED: To provide a carrier for electrostatic latent image development which hardly causes carrier adhesion in the initial stage and with the lapse of time, gives high image density and good graininess (roughness), has stable charge imparting power over a long period of time, and suppresses environmental variation of electrostatic charging property and reduction in electrostatic charge left standing. SOLUTION: The carrier for electrostatic latent image development comprises magnetic core material particles and a coating layer formed on the core material particle surface, wherein the carrier has a weight average particle diameter Dw of 22-32μm and a ratio Dw/Dp of >1.0 to <1.2, wherein Dp represents a number average particle diameter of the carrier, and includes carrier particles having a particle diameter of <20μm in an amount of 0-7 wt.% and carrier particles having a particle diameter of <36μm in an amount of 90-100 wt.%, and the core material particles have related values of electric resistivity under specific conditions within a predetermined range each.
